#50e73e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#50e73e is composed of 31.4% red, 90.6%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.2%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 113.6 degrees, a saturation of 77.9% and a lightness of 57.5%. #50e73e color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ff7c with #00cf00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#50e73e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#50e73e has RGB values of R:80, G:231,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 5302078.

Shades and Tints of #50e73e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#041002 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#50e73e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929491 is the less saturated color, while #43f82d is the most saturated one.
